The idea behind this poll is a good one, but I don't think this is the right way to go about it.
This way, we'll probably end up going with the date which has the most votes, which could be the best date for 60% of people, but a date which 40% of people can't make it to. It would be better to have it on whichever day could attract the most people, even if it's not the best date for so many.
Do these forums have the possibility of multiple choice polls? If we could have a poll that was "Vote for all the dates you could make it on", that'd be a lot better.
